Likewise, people ask, what is the difference between data and information?Data is raw, unorganized facts that need to be processed. Data can be something simple and seemingly random and useless until it is organized. When data is processed, organized, structured or presented in a given context so as to make it useful, it is called information. Knowledge is created by the very flow of information, anchored in the beliefs and commitment of its holder.”What is the difference between quantitative data and qualitative data in what situations could the number 42 be considered qualitative data?Quantitative data is numeric, the result of a measurement, count, or some other mathematical calculation. Qualitative data is descriptive. The number 42 could be qualitative if it is a designation instead of a measurement, count, or calculation.
